## Redis指令创建Hash
### 引言
在使用Redis时,我们经常需要存储和处理键值对的数据结构。Redis提供了多种数据结构,其中之一就是Hash。Hash是一种键值对的集合,其中每个键都是唯一的,它可以存储多个键值对,并且可以通过键来进行快速查找和访问。在本文中,我们将介绍Redis中创建Hash的指令及其用法。
### Redis Hash指令
Redis提供了一系列的指令
原创
2023-08-27 07:36:29
90阅读
## 如何使用Redis指令创建Hash
作为一名经验丰富的开发者,我很高兴能够教会你如何使用Redis指令创建Hash。Redis是一个高性能的键值存储系统,其提供了丰富的指令来操作数据。下面我会一步步告诉你整个流程,并提供相应的代码示例。
### 步骤概述
下面是使用Redis指令创建Hash的步骤概述:
| 步骤 | 描述 |
| --- | --- |
| 1 | 连接到Redis
原创
2023-07-31 08:20:38
79阅读
# Redis指令创建Hash Set
## 什么是Redis?
Redis(Remote Dictionary Server)是一个使用C语言编写的开源内存数据库,它提供了一个高度可扩展的键值存储系统。Redis支持多种数据结构,包括字符串、列表、集合、有序集合和哈希等。Redis的优势在于其高性能和灵活性,它可以用于缓存、消息队列、计数器、排行榜、实时分析等多种场景。
## Hash S
原创
2023-07-20 22:34:11
53阅读
《Redis设计与实现》黄建宏版的读书笔记哈希表哈希表(hash table):又叫散列表,是根据关键码值进行访问的数据结构。将关键码值映射到表中的一个位置来访问,以加快查找的速度。这个函数映射叫做哈希函数,存放记录的数组叫做散列表。哈希表常用于通过key快速的找到对应的value时使用。哈希表的负载因子等于实际元素数目/哈希表的容量,负载因子越大表示冲突越大,负载因子越小,表示空间越浪费。一般负
转载
2023-08-10 09:07:01
137阅读
hashes类型hashes类型及操作Redis hash是一个string类型的field和value的映射表。它的添加、删除操作都是0(1)(平均)。hash特别适合用于存储对象。相较于将对象的每个字段存成单个string类型。将一个对象存储在hash类型中会占用更少的内存,并且更方便的存取整个对象。hset设置hash field为指定值,如果key不存在,则先创建 127.0.0.1:6
转载
2023-07-09 22:10:20
70阅读
# 如何在Redis中创建Hash Key
作为一名经验丰富的开发者,我很乐意教你如何在Redis中创建Hash Key。在开始之前,我们需要明确一些基本概念。Redis是一个高性能的键值存储数据库,它支持多种数据结构,包括字符串、列表、集合、有序集合和哈希。哈希是Redis中的一个重要数据结构,它类似于关系型数据库中的表,可以存储多个键值对。
下面是创建Redis哈希键的步骤:
| 步骤
原创
2023-08-03 08:09:51
789阅读
# 使用 Redis 创建 Hash 键值的详细教程
Redis 是一个高性能的键值存储数据库,广泛应用于缓存和数据持久化场景。本文将通过详细的步骤引导你创建 Redis Hash 键值。我们将介绍创建 Hash 的流程、所需代码及其注释,帮助你更好地理解每一步。
## 整体流程概览
在这个部分,我们将整合代码实现的整体流程。我们可以将这个流程分为以下几个步骤:
| 步骤 | 描述
原创
2024-08-17 05:05:08
42阅读
# Redis创建空Hash
Redis是一个高性能的键值存储数据库,它支持多种数据结构,包括字符串、列表、集合、有序集合和哈希等。在Redis中,哈希是一种键值对的集合,其中每个键对应一个值。
在本文中,我们将学习如何在Redis中创建一个空的哈希,并使用示例代码演示。
## Redis连接和初始化
首先,我们需要安装Redis并连接到Redis服务器。通过Redis的客户端库,我们可以在各
原创
2023-07-23 08:59:37
215阅读
Jedis1. 概述Jedis 是一款使用 Java 操作 Redis 的工具,有点类似于 JDBC2. 引入依赖<dependency>
<groupId>redis.clients</groupId>
<artifactId>jedis</artifactId>
<version>2.9.0<
转载
2023-05-22 11:12:05
122阅读
1. 前言老板突然要上线一个需求,获取当前位置方圆一公里的业务代理点。明天上线!当接到这个需求的时候我差点吐血,这时间也太紧张了。赶紧去查相关的技术选型。经过一番折腾,终于在晚上十点完成了这个需求。现在把大致实现的思路总结一下。 图12. MySQL 不合适遇到需求,首先要想到现有的东西能不能满足,成本如何。MySQL是我首先能够想到的,毕竟大部分数据要持久化到MySQL。但是使用MySQL需要自
转载
2024-06-26 10:43:01
23阅读
# 如何在Redis中创建数据库
## 1. 整体流程
为了在Redis中创建数据库,我们需要执行以下步骤:
```mermaid
erDiagram
USER ||--o| COMMAND: "创建数据库"
```
- 步骤1:连接到Redis服务器
- 步骤2:执行创建数据库指令
## 2. 具体步骤及代码示例
### 步骤1:连接到Redis服务器
首先,你需要连接到R
原创
2024-03-25 06:40:29
36阅读
redis 设置密码访问 你的 redis 在真是环境中不可以谁想访问就可以访问,所以必须要设置密码 设置密码的流程如下: vim /etc/redis.conf #requirepass foobared 去掉注释,foobared 改为自己的密码,我在这里改为 requirepass 123456 然后保存,重启服务 cd /usr/local/bin ./redis-server /etc
转载
2023-05-25 13:23:07
89阅读
一, 图解 字典的实现Redis的字典使用哈希表作为底层实现,一个哈希表里面可以有多个哈希表节点,而每个哈希表节点就保存了字典中的一个键值对。接下来分别介绍Redis的哈希表、哈希表节点以及字典的实现。哈希表Redis字典所使用的哈希表由dict.h/dictht结构定义:/*
* 哈希表
*
* 每个字典都使用两个哈希表,从而实现渐进式 rehash 。
*/
typedef
转载
2023-11-25 19:35:04
46阅读
@TOC(目录)Redis常见命令Redis是典型的keyvalue数据库:key一般是字符串,而value包含很多不同的数据类型:!(https://s2.51cto.com/images/blog/202209/07230846_6318b3fe9b39575089.png?xossprocess=image/watermark,size_14,text_QDUxQ1RP5Y2a5a6i,co
原创
精选
2022-09-07 23:12:33
910阅读
点赞
# Redis创建hash表命令详解
Redis是一款开源的内存数据库,广泛应用于缓存、消息队列、会话管理等场景。其中hash表是Redis中重要的数据结构之一,可以存储多个键值对,适用于存储对象属性、配置信息等。本文将介绍Redis中创建hash表的命令及示例代码,帮助读者更好地理解和使用Redis的hash表功能。
## Redis创建hash表命令
在Redis中,可以通过`HSET`
原创
2024-06-27 05:50:25
56阅读
# Redis Hash的创建与打开
## 介绍
在使用Redis存储数据时,Hash是一种常用的数据结构。它可以将多个键值对存储在一个键下,类似于关系型数据库中的表。
本文将向刚入行的开发者介绍如何在Redis中创建或打开一个Hash,并提供相应的代码示例。
## 创建或打开Hash的流程
下面是创建或打开Hash的整个流程,通过表格展示每一步需要做什么。
| 步骤 | 操作 |
|
原创
2024-02-05 03:44:46
32阅读
Redis设置密码 设置密码有两种方式。1. 命令行设置密码。先启动服务端[root@tata-mysql-qa bin]# ./redis-cli -h 172.16.188.81客户端使用config get requirepass命令查看密码>config get requirepass
1)"requirepass"
2)"" //默认空客户端
转载
2023-06-28 16:36:50
98阅读
加载redis.cof文件命令: redis-server /etc/redis/redis.conf启动redis命令: redis-cli -p 6379 关于key命令:keys * //查看所有的Key:set/get key //给key设置值:expire key 200 //设置key的存活时间200s:exists key //判断key是否存在move key db
转载
2023-06-26 14:11:30
228阅读
Redis 有序集合基本操作1. 有序集合常用命令2. 添加有序集合3. 计算成员个数4. 查看成员分数5. 按照降序查看成员名次(从0开始)6. 按照升序查看成员名次(从0开始)7. 删除成员8. 返回指定排名范围的成员9. 返回指定分数范围的成员10. 增加成员分数 1. 有序集合常用命令命令含义用法ZADD创建有序集合ZADD keyZCARD查看有序集合成员格式ZCARD keySDIF
转载
2023-05-25 12:44:14
70阅读
文章目录Redis一、Redis常用命令1. Redis常用命令2. String类型常见命令3. Hash类型的常见命令4. List类型的常见命令5. Set类型的常见类型6. SortedSet类型的常见命令二、RedisTemplate的两种序列化方式1. 为什么要序列化?2. 序列化的两种方式1. 自定义RedisTemplate2. 使用StringRedisTemplate Red
转载
2023-08-16 09:59:26
139阅读